Be Aware: Spotting Fraudulent Forex Brokers

Venturing into the world of forex trading can be appealing, but it's crucial to be cautious of potential scams. Regrettably, the forex market attracts its share of dishonest brokers who aim to deceive unsuspecting traders. To protect yourself from falling prey to these schemes, it's essential to understand the warning signs that{ signal a fake forex broker.

  • One key sign is the broker's licensing. Legitimate brokers are always registered with reputable financial authorities. Always confirm their credentials through official sources.
  • Examine the broker's performance. Look for reviews and testimonials from other traders, and be wary of brokers with vague information about their past operations.
  • Assertions of guaranteed profits or unrealistic returns are a major cause for concern. No legitimate broker can promise consistent profits in the volatile forex market.

Moreover, be cautious of brokers who coerce you into making immediate decisions or depositing large sums of money without proper consideration. Take your time, compare different brokers, and make informed choices based on reliable information.

Dissecting The Broker Review Maze: A Guide to Avoiding Deception

Broker reviews can be a valuable resource for researching potential financial advisors. Yet, the industry is rife with fabricated reviews that aim to bamboozle unsuspecting investors. To protect yourself from these fraudulent tactics, it's crucial to develop a discerning eye and consider reviews with wariness.

  • Examine the source: Pay close attention to the platform where the review resides. Established and trusted platforms tend to have rigorous verification systems in place.
  • Beware overly positive reviews that lack any counterpoints. A balanced review will reflect both the advantages and limitations of the broker.
  • Search for specific details: Genuine reviews usually mention concrete information about the broker's products. Vague statements should raise a concern.
